Cleaning vs. Normal Cleaning: Regular or Normal cleaning is usually
performed from time to time at our home, offices, or space to get rid of the
dirt and dust. While the Bond Cleaning is a
deep cleaning that usually includes vacuuming all carpets and mopping of the
floors or cleaning the kitchen and bathroom from the deep inside and out.
Difference
between Bond Cleaning and Normal Cleaning
There is a huge difference between these two
types of cleaning i.e. cleaning techniques, tools used to clean and the cost
etc. However, both are required for cleaning. Despite this, they have different
parameters to clean that create a difference in between.
People living in Australia usually hire a bond
cleaner as they have to get their bond amount back. Let's get some more clarity
with an example.
Suppose the tenancy agreement is over and you
are about to move on to your next destination. Some uncertainty of getting the
bond money back is quite frustrating and stressful as well. You are about to
face a dispute with your landlord or caretaker over cleanliness due to the
cleaning standard of the rental property.
In this scenario, people often use the service
of a bond cleaning as the bond
cleaner helps you get back the bond money with their skills and with the help
of modern tools and techniques they clean the property thoroughly. However, in
normal cleaning, there is nothing to do with deep cleaning.
In regular cleaning, there is no involvement
of the property owner or manager. People practice it to clean the dust from
their property. In short, regular cleaning is normal cleaning that everyone
practices, especially people having their own houses, whereas bond cleaning applies to the tenants-rental
property.
Use
of Advanced Cleaning Tools
During a deep cleaning, the cleaners use
different types of advanced tools and techniques they are trained for. They use
tools like polishers & burnishers, vacuums, specialty machines, floor
sanders, scrubbers/dryers, and so on for deep cleaning. However, we are unable
to use such tools and techniques at home for regular cleaning.
Bond
cleaning provides the above-mentioned powerful tools only to provide the
premium quality of cleaning for the neglected areas of your home or space. And
hence, it becomes the responsibility of the professionals to make sure all
surfaces, including carpet and wooden, are cleaned appropriately.
Except for using these small tools, the
professional deep cleaners also use small tools to clean electronic items like
refrigerators, water coolers, washing machines, geysers, and other heavy
appliances. However, in normal cleanings, you use only a duster, mops, brooms,
vacuums, and other small necessary tools to clean your home appliances. And
these tools are easily available either at your home or nearby shops.
